The Chapter of Maryam
There is a Chapter in the Holy Qur’ân, named Surat u Maryam "Chapter Mary", named in honor of Mary the mother of Jesus Christ, peace and blessings of Allah be upon him; again, such an honor is not to be found given to Mary in the Christian Bible. Out of the 66 books of the Protestants and 73 of the Roman Catholics, not one is named after Mary or her son. You will find books named after Matthew, Mark, Luke, John, Peter, Paul and two score more obscure names, but not a single one is that of Mary! If Muhammed, salla Allah u alihi wa sallam, was the author of the Holy Qur’ân, then he would not have failed to include in it with Mary, the mother of Jesus, his own mother Aamina, his dear wife Khadija, or his beloved daughter Fatimah. But No! No! This can never be. The Qur’ân is not his handiwork!. |
